Job Description

Responsibilities

Core Function

The Corporate Communications Executive plays a key role in advancing SUN-DAC's visibility, brand, and mission through integrated communications, storytelling, and stakeholder engagement.
The role is responsible for developing and executing content across digital and traditional channels, managing social media and digital platforms, supporting branding and publicity efforts, and producing compelling communications materials that showcase SUN-DAC's impact. The Corporate Communications Executive will work closely with internal and external stakeholders to strengthen awareness, engagement, and support for the organisation's programmes and beneficiaries.

Core Responsibilities

  • Executes communications and media initiatives to enhance SUN-DAC's visibility and brand presence
  • Creates and manages content across digital channels, including social media, website, EDMs, and newsletters (internal and external)
  • Captures and produces engaging photo and video content for programmes, events, and beneficiary stories
  • Manages SUN-DAC's social media platforms, driving audience growth and engagement
  • Develops communications materials, including website content, annual reports, marketing collateral, and stakeholder communications
  • Coordinates with internal teams and external stakeholders to ensure consistent and effective messaging
  • Designs and produces marketing and communications materials for campaigns, events, and organisational initiatives
  • Monitors and reports on digital communications performance and audience engagement

Core Job Requirements

Education

  • Diploma or Degree in Communications, Marketing, Media, Public Relations, or a related field

Experience

  • At least 2 years of relevant experience in communications, content creation, marketing, or public relations

Skills

  • Strong writing, communication, and project coordination skills
  • Proficient in social media management, digital marketing, and audience engagement
  • Skilled in Canva and/or Adobe Creative Suite, with experience in video editing tools such as CapCut or similar
  • Familiarity with CMS platforms (e.g. WordPress) and EDM platforms (e.g. Mailchimp) is advantageous
  • Creative, proactive, detail-oriented, and passionate about social impact and inclusive communications
